Woods was raised by his father, who was a navy seal in the US Army. Other than being his father, Earl Woods was also Tiger’s coach as well as his mentor for life. And the golfer has talked about his relationship with his father in several interviews. Woods has also disclosed that despite his father being in the army, his mother was stricter.

via Reuters

However, in a recent interview, Woods discussed a very strange habit of not carrying an umbrella no matter how much it rains. And it’s not because someone else carries it for him. It’s because his father taught him something that he would never forget. The golfer said that he never carried an umbrella to the field, nor did he wear a rain jacket.

He recalled his father’s mentality about playing in the rain and said“I don’t mind being wet because pops used to say, ‘Once you’re wet, you’re wet! Deal with it. You only get wet once’” He stated that maybe it was because of his father being in the navy that he knew what it meant to face difficulties and stand strong. What does Woods do to play in the rain?

ADVERTISEMENT

Article continues below this ad

Rather than using an umbrella to stay dry, Woods likes to face the water head-on and compete. However, it is not the same for his equipment. The golfer’s caddie carries at least 2 towels to make sure that the clubs are wiped before every shot. He also disclosed carrying around 15-16 gloves to a tournament when it’s raining.
